Abstract
PURPOSE:To reduce the latent expansibility and collapsibility of converter slag in a short time by forming slag grains to the state of requiring no recrushing, wetting these, leaving these in a piled state, and maintaining the same for a specific period in the water satd. state. CONSTITUTION:Slag grains are formed in the state of requiring no recrushing, and after the crushing, water is sprayed for at least within about 1-2 days to supply water, thereby wetting these. This is left in a piled state under natural condition for at least 15 days. The slag grain collapsing phenomena occuring during this period are considerable, and thereafter, they decrease gradually. Water is again supplied to the slag grains in the state of virtual completion of the collapsion to keep the grains in a satd. state, and in this state they are maintained for at least 30 days. Thereby, the effect of a sharp decrease in the rate of expansion of the slag material is observed, and the slag of low rates of expansion and good quality is obtained easily.
